Iran suspends football clubs over attacks
Wednesday, 15 April 2026 at 10:37 UTC · 1 source
Iran's Ministry of Industry, Mine and Trade has officially suspended two football clubs, Sepahan and Foolad Khuzestan, from participating in the remainder of the Premier League. The decision was communicated in a letter to the Premier Football League Organization, citing recent attacks on the country that have damaged parts of industrial infrastructure. The clubs will not be allowed to play any official matches until further notice, pending the reopening and resumption of activities at the affected industrial companies. This move highlights the broader impact of security incidents on civilian and cultural sectors in Iran.
